Transaction 6662086d27a06e3b8fca19048fa12335430bd0a7e4805be1f405707cbec5b755
1 Input
1 Output
-
6662086d27a06e3b8fca19048fa12335430bd0a7e4805be1f405707cbec5b755:0
- value
- 6196
- script pubkey
- OP_0 OP_PUSHBYTES_20 8970e8aabda988b8b7f65ee80c447d7109018b43
- address
- bc1q39cw324a4xyt3dlktm5qc3rawyysrz6rmnen8k